Illusions of this type trick the eye and brain into seeing things that aren't really there or misinterpreting things. Various factors can contribute to this, including color, contrast, lighting, and perspective. Or it can be a lot of detail that makes the eye wander around the picture and not catch the small details.

People who are able to solve such optical illusions are usually attentive to detail, able to think critically and solve problems.
